认识区块链钱包:你要知道的基本概念

大家好,今天想和大家聊聊区块链钱包的开发,尤其是在深圳这样一个科技氛围特别浓厚的地方。在这个话题上,首先得弄清楚什么是区块链钱包。简单说,区块链钱包就是用来存储、管理加密货币的工具。说它是一把钥匙也不为过,因为没有它,你根本打不开那些数字资产的大门。

如果我们把加密货币比作钱,那钱包就是你真实生活中的荷包。但是,这个“荷包”并不是纸做的,而是由数字技术构建的。像比特币、以太坊等加密币,它们的背后全靠这种钱包来保障安全性和便捷性。

区块链钱包的类型:冷热钱包大比拼

在开始开发前,我们得了解一下钱包的类型。区块链钱包主要分为热钱包和冷钱包。

热钱包:它一直连着互联网,使用非常方便,比如手机APP、网页钱包等。想想你每天用的支付宝、微信,随时随地买买买,真的超级方便。但与此同时,热钱包的风险也大,因为它容易受到黑客攻击。

冷钱包:就是像一个大型的金库,完全不连网。它存储的信息相对安全,适合长时间储存大额资金。冷钱包的代表就是硬件钱包,比如Ledger、Trezor等。你要真的用它,得插上设备,然后操作才能使它“复活”。所以,虽然访问不便,但安全性极高。

为什么在深圳开发区块链钱包?

深圳这座城市,科技力量不容小觑。这里有腾讯、华为这样的大企业,也有无数的初创公司。靠谱的技术团队、充足的资源还有创新的氛围都为区块链钱包的开发提供了极好的土壤。

想说的是,去年有家新兴公司就选择在深圳开发区块链钱包,结果通过用户体验,迅速攻占市场。短短几个月,他们的用户量就破了十万人,真的是不得不佩服深圳的创造力与活力。

如何着手进行区块链钱包的开发?

先来聊聊从零开始的几个步骤。首先,技术选型非常关键。如果你是团队的技术负责人,必须考虑好选择哪种区块链技术。像比特币、以太坊、EOS等,各有各的特点和应用场景。

接下来,你需要搭建环境。比如在以太坊上,你可能需要安装一些开发工具,如Truffle、Ganache等。这些工具能帮助开发者更好地编写智能合约,以及快速进行开发与测试。

写代码是不容忽视的环节。我的朋友小李,他刚开始接触这个领域的时候,学得可辛苦了。毕竟要掌握Solidity这样的编程语言,真的是一个不小的挑战。不过,经过一段时间的努力,他终于能自己开发出一些简单的功能了。

重视用户体验:从设计入手

这里我想强调整个钱包的用户体验。就像我们常用的APP一样,好的界面设计能够让人爱不释手。在进行区块链钱包的设计时,一个清晰的界面,便捷的操作步骤都是少不了的。

我有个朋友的投资项目,最开始他花了很多精力在技术上,忽略了界面的友好性。结果上线后用户反馈非常差,大家都觉得操作复杂,最后不得不重新设计。后来吸取教训的他,借鉴了一些比较成功的钱包设计,结果第二次发布时,用户体验大大提升,满意度直线上升。

安全性:保障用户资产的重中之重

在区块链钱包开发中,安全性绝对是第一位的。通过哪些措施来保障呢?首先,使用多重签名技术,简而言之,就是需要多个私钥才能完成交易。这样即使其中某个密钥泄露了,钱也不至于被轻易盗走。

还有定期的安全审计。我的一位朋友,他所在的区块链公司每季度都要进行一次系统的安全审查,确保代码没有漏洞。就像年前一轮大规模的黑客攻击导致了不少用户损失,他们的团队经过反复测试、增强安全性,才把用户的信心重新赢回来。

市场推广:怎么玩才有效

那么,开发有了,怎样推广才能让更多人知道你?有了一个好的产品,接下来就是如何把它推向市场。

利用社交媒体,如微信群、QQ群、微博等,都是不错的渠道。去年我看到一款新钱包,通过微信社群进行裂变营销,很快就吸引了一波用户。我一开始还不太相信,后来关注他们品牌的信息一看,果然用户增长趋近爆发!

持续更新和维护:保持竞争力

最后一点,别小看了钱包的后期更新与维护。这些是为了适应市场的不断变化。比如有次我使用的某款钱包,刚开始很好用,但后来没有频繁更新,用户渐渐流失,最后不得不关闭服务。

保持与时俱进,推出新功能,及时修复bug,都是钱包开发过程中不可或缺的一部分。有些团队会定期进行用户反馈会,收集用户的建议,做到更精准的产品升级。

结尾:你的区块链钱包开发之路

说了这么多,希望大家能对区块链钱包的开发有一个全面的了解。不管你是团队负责人,还是想入行的新人,只要认真去学习、尝试,总会找到适合自己的发展路径。

如果有更多的疑问,欢迎和我聊聊。咱们一起探讨,分享彼此的经验。深圳是充满机遇的地方,这里有太多等待挖掘的宝藏,期待你们的加入!